
➤ Allow only qualified and authorized electricians or trained personnel under the supervision of a
qualified and authorized electrician to carry out work on electrical equipment according to elec‐
trical engineering regulations.
➤ Before commissioning or re-commissioning the machine, the user must make sure there is ad‐
equate protection against electric shock from direct or indirect contact.
➤ Before starting any work on electrical equipment:
Switch off and lock out the power supply disconnecting device and verify the absence of volt‐
age.
➤ Switch off any external power sources.
These may include devices connected to the floating relay contacts.
➤ Use fuses corresponding to machine power.
➤ Check regularly that all electrical connections are tight and in proper condition.
Forces of compression
Compressed air is contained energy. Uncontrolled release of this energy can cause serious injury
or death. The following information concerns work on components that could be under pressure.
➤ Close shut-off valves or otherwise isolate the machine from the distribution network to ensure
that no compressed air can flow back into the machine.
➤ Depressurize all pressurized components and enclosures.
➤ Do not carry out welding, heat treatment or mechanical modifications to pressurized compo‐
nents (e.g. pipes and vessels) as this influences the component's resistance to pressure.
The safety of the machine is then no longer ensured.
Rotating components
Touching the fan while the machine is switched on can result in serious injury.
➤ Do not open the enclosure while the machine is switched on.
➤ Switch off and lock out the power supply disconnecting device and verify the absence of volt‐
age.
➤ Wear close-fitting clothes and a hair net if necessary.
➤ Ensure that all covers and safety guards are in place and secured before restarting.
Temperature
High temperatures are generated during compression. Touching hot components may cause inju‐
ries.
➤ Avoid contact with hot components.
These include, for example, the refrigerant condenser.
➤ Wear protective clothing.
➤ If welding is carried out on or near the machine take adequate measures to ensure that no
parts of the machine can ignite because of sparks or heat.
Operating fluids/materials
The used operating fluids and materials can cause adverse health effects. Suitable safety meas‐
ures must be taken in order to prevent injuries.
➤ Strictly forbid fire, open flame and smoking.
➤ Follow safety regulations when dealing with refrigerant and chemical substances.
➤ Avoid contact with skin and eyes.
